The Arcade Club first arrived in 2015 but since reopening from lockdown it's proved a huge hit with players young and old. Nothing short of a gamer's paradise, three floors of Ela Mill in Bury are packed with more than 400 machines - from classic and modern arcade games, to pinball machines and so much more.
